Ingredients
For the Brisket
- 3 pounds beef brisket
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1 teaspoon black pepper
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1 teaspoon onion powder
- 1 teaspoon paprika
For the Filling
- 2 tablespoons butter
- 1 large onion, diced
- 3 carrots, diced
- 2 celery stalks, diced
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 cup frozen peas
- 2 medium potatoes, diced
- ¼ cup all-purpose flour
- 3 cups beef broth
- 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
- 1 teaspoon dried thyme
- 1 teaspoon dried rosemary
For the Crust
- 2 refrigerated pie crusts or homemade pastry dough
- 1 large egg
- 1 tablespoon water
Optional Ingredients
- Mushrooms
- Corn kernels
- Parsnips
- Fresh parsley
- Sharp cheddar cheese
Instructions
Step 1: Prepare the Brisket
Preheat oven to:
- 325°F (163°C)
Season brisket with:
- Salt
- Pepper
- Garlic powder
- Onion powder
- Paprika
Heat olive oil in a Dutch oven and sear brisket on all sides until browned.
Step 2: Slow Cook the Brisket
Add:
- 2 cups beef broth
Cover and cook for:
- 3–4 hours
until fork tender.
Remove and allow to cool slightly.
Shred or cube the brisket.
Step 3: Prepare the Filling
In a large skillet melt butter.
Add:
- Onion
- Carrots
- Celery
Cook for 5–7 minutes.
Add garlic and cook for 1 minute.
Step 4: Create the Gravy
Sprinkle flour over vegetables.
Cook for 1 minute while stirring.
Gradually whisk in:
- Beef broth
- Worcestershire sauce
Add:
- Thyme
- Rosemary
Simmer until thickened.
Step 5: Add Brisket and Vegetables
Stir in:
- Shredded brisket
- Potatoes
- Peas
Cook for 5–10 minutes.
Allow mixture to cool slightly.
Step 6: Assemble the Pot Pie
Preheat oven to:
- 400°F (200°C)
Place one pie crust into a deep pie dish.
Fill with brisket mixture.
Cover with second crust.
Seal and crimp edges.
Cut small vents in the top.
Step 7: Egg Wash
Whisk together:
- Egg
- Water
Brush over the top crust.
Step 8: Bake
Bake for:
- 35–45 minutes
until golden brown and bubbling.
Step 9: Rest and Serve
Allow pot pie to rest for:
- 10–15 minutes
before slicing.
Serve warm.

History
Pot pies have been enjoyed for centuries and trace their origins to ancient meat pies prepared in Europe. These early pies used pastry as both a cooking vessel and a method of preserving food.
Brisket became especially popular in American cooking due to its affordability and ability to become tender through slow cooking. Combining brisket with pot pie traditions created a hearty and practical meal that maximized flavor and reduced food waste.
Today, brisket pot pie is considered an elevated comfort food that blends classic pie-making with rich beef traditions.

Extra Methods and Variations
Smoked Brisket Pot Pie
Use smoked brisket for deeper flavor.
Cheesy Brisket Pot Pie
Add shredded cheddar cheese to the filling.
Mushroom Brisket Pot Pie
Include sautéed mushrooms for earthy richness.
Guinness Brisket Pot Pie
Replace part of the broth with stout beer.
Rustic Open-Faced Version
Use only a top crust for a lighter pie.
